Job Description: 

Job Description

 

• Must be high-energy, detail-oriented, proactive and have the ability to function under pressure in an independent environment.

• Understanding of software development processes including SAFe/Agile processes

• Proficiency with Java SDK 11 or greater

• Experience of Tomcat, shell scripting, JSON, multi-threading, Maven, Linux, SQL, Pivotal, Kafka and Spring framework tech stack

• Expertise with Eclipse or IntelliJ and ability to compile, deploy and execute code artefacts

• Understanding of secure coding best practices

• Experience with cloud software development (PCF)

• Strong verbal and written communication skill

• Work with a team of talented engineers to develop high performance, high volume Java applications.

• Deliver solutions by providing direct development of software functionality.

• Comprehend user stories to understand task items per story in the context of development and testing (unit, functional, integration, and regression)

• Work closely with technical leads, testers, business & system analysts to define features and user stories.

• Assistance with production support issues by acting as point-of-contact and subject matter expert in resolving incidents and problem tickets.

• Familiar with secure coding standards (e.g., OWASP, CWE, SEI CERT)

• Understands and implements standard branching (e.g., Gitflow) and peer review practices

• Apply tools (e.g., Sonar, Zally, Checkmarx ) and techniques to scan and measure code quality and anti-patterns as part of development activity

• Understands and builds test code at unit level, service level, and integration level to ensure code and functional coverage

• Understands the use of basic design patterns (e.g., factory, adaptor, singleton, composite, observer, strategy, inversion of control)

• Understands requirement analysis being essential part of delivering value to our customers and partners and participate in elaboration, prioritization, and effort estimation

• Understands different SDLC practices (Waterfall/Scrum/Kanban/SAFe) and the delivery situations they are used for

• Understands the basic engineering principles used in building and running mission critical software capabilities (security, customer experience, testing, operability, simplification, service-oriented architecture)

• Familiar with different application patterns to implement different types of business processes (e.g., APIs, event-driven-services, batch-services, web-applications, big data)

• Understands Continuous Integration (CI) and Delivery (CD) concepts, and capabilities to support automation, pipelines, virtualization, and containerization

• Considerate, polite, fun-loving, collaborative, curious problem-solver

Mandatory Skills: Java-J2EE .

 

Experience: 5-8 Years .
